基于ASP.NET新闻发布网站的设计与实现

来源 :科学导报·学术 | 被引量 : 0次 | 上传用户:ljsamuel
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
  摘要: 本论文给出一种基于ASP.NET的新闻发布网站设计与实现,系统基于B/S运行模式,采用ASP.NET和SQL Server数据库实现。自互联网进入中国,新闻媒体一直是其最重要的应用之一,ASP.NET凭借其功能强大、灵活、简易、安全等特点,成为新闻发布网站设计与实现的首选技术。本新闻发布网站在设计上采用模块化设计,通过数据库来存储新闻信息数据,用户可借助浏览器界面与WEB网站进行各种交互。网站实现了对新闻数据的浏览、查询、编辑和管理等基本功能。
  关键词: ASP.NET;新闻发布;B/S模式;数据库;SQL Server。
  中图分类号: TP39 文献标识码:A
  0 引言
  在当今的信息化时代,借助互联网技术的支持,人们更多的通过网络来获取各种新闻信息。WEB是互联网技术的发展核心之一,WEB技术最初是基于静态HTML页面,但随着动态页面技术需求的不断强化,已被ASP.NET之类的脚本语言所取代,这也导致WEB的功能不再局限于单纯的提供信息,还可以进行动态页面的交互,甚至是数据库查询等等,为用户提供了强大的服务功能[1-4]。
  本文探讨设计并实现一个基于ASP.NET的新闻发布网站,旨在提供一个高效的动态新闻管理平台。提供用户前台搜索浏览新闻、管理员后台完成新闻更新管理等功能。从而为用户提供一个性能优秀,便捷易用,交互体验良好的新闻网站进行新闻的浏览,同时也为管理员提供方便的信息管理环境,减少网站开发运营的成本,加快新闻的更新,加强管理员对网站的掌控力。
  1 网站设计
  1.1 网站功能分析
  网站需求主要分成前台用户模块和后台管理员模块两部分[5-7]。用户模块的功能主要包括:新闻搜索与浏览,跳转到新闻内容详细显示页面等;管理员模块的主要功能包括:管理员登录、对新闻和用户信息进行修改等。具体功能说明如下:
  (1)前台功能
  用户登录:进行用户身份验证
  新闻阅览:用户可以在首页直接浏览新闻。
  关键字搜索新闻:用户可以通过搜索栏输入关键字,搜索自己想要找的新闻。
  新闻细节展示:首页位置有限,只能显示新闻的标题,点击标题将跳转到另一页面以显示新闻的全部内容。
  (2)后台功能
  网站的后台管理主要是后台登录、新闻管理和用户管理。具体功能如下:
  管理员后台登录:网站信息的修改权限专属于管理员,其后台登录功能通过用户名、密码检测管理员身份的合法性。
  新聞的添加、删除与更新。
  用户信息的添加、删除与更新。
  1.2 网站流程分析
  新闻发布网站工作流程为:打开网站首页后,管理员输入正确的用户名及密码后进入后台管理,对网站新闻信息进行查询、发布、修改、删除等操作,这些数据的修改保存后会自动写入后台数据库,并即时在网站上显示。而用户进入首页后,可以直接进行关键字新闻搜索与浏览。
  1.3 网站功能模块划分设计
  根据新闻网站的预定功能需求,我们将各功能模块划分如下,如图所示:
  2 数据库设计
  新闻发布网站作为一个信息的集散平台,最重要的就是对信息数据的处理,数据库设计是新闻网站数据管理设计的核心部分,是对大量新闻信息、用户数据信息进行录入、存储、修改等功能的基础[8-9]。作为一个新闻发布网站,其数据库必须能够承受信息的频繁更新与修改,既能提供详尽的数据,也能同步修改管理员在WEB页面进行的数据修改。
  网站的数据信息集中在管理员信息、用户信息、新闻信息这三大块,据此所以我们围绕着这三个实体构建数据库。分别建立Admin(管理员信息表)存储管理员信息;Users(用户信息表)存储用户信息,News(新闻信息表)存储新闻信息
  ASP.NET中使用ADO.NET为编程者提供了强大而灵活的数据库操作功能,本WEB设计中使用ADO.NET内置对象完成与数据库的交互,具体包括Connection对象、Command对象、DataReader对象、DataAdapter对象和DataSet对象等。
  3 结语
  本网站基于C#、ASP.NET及SQL server开发,构建完成了一个小型的新闻发布网站。用户可通过WEB界面进行用户登录、新闻浏览以及搜索等操作;管理员则拥有更新网站数据的权限。网站的全部信息数据存储在数据库中,管理员在其页面可直接修改新闻,其数据也会同步修改到数据库中。最终构建了一个基于ASP.NET新闻发布网站,测试结果表明达到了预期的设计目标。
  参考文献
  [1]李文华. 高校图书馆新闻管理系统的分析与设计[J]. 计算机光盘软件与应用, 2014, 1723:283-284.
  [2]王莉利, 高新成, 王才智. 基于动转静技术的新闻系统的设计与实现[J]. 陕西理工学院学报(自然科学版), 2015, 3102:41-44.
  [3]张佳. ASP.NET中细分新闻类网站的用户对页面的操作权限[J]. 黄山学院学报, 2015, 1705:37-39.
  [4]杨晨. 基于ASP网上图书销售系统的设计与实现[J]. 电子世界, 2014, 15:119.
  [5]肖建田. 基于《ASP.NET程序设计》课程的教学改革初探[J]. 现代计算机(专业版), 2014, 27:24-28.
  [6]张克. 基于asp.net新闻管理系统的设计与实现[J]. 电子制作, 2014, 11:84-85.
  [7]鞠武利. 基于.NET技术的达县公安局警务新闻发布与管理系统的设计与实现[D]. 电子科技大学, 2014.
  [8]刘俊竹. 基于ASP.NET汽车企业门户网站的设计与实现[D]. 吉林大学, 2015.
  [9]杨正. 报社设备管理系统的设计与实现[D]. 华南理工大学, 2014.
  作者简介:
  1. 张利民,(1964年出生),女,河北省人,1986年毕业于西北师范大学,副教授;主要研究方向:消费者行为学,电子商务。
其他文献
摘要: 随着国民经济的快速发展,我国居民的生活水平在不断提高,对健康的要求也越来越高。营养与食品卫生和居民的健康密切相关,本文以营养与食品卫生学实验教学为切入点,分析其教学现状并提出对策,仅供参考  关键词: 营养与食品卫生;实验教学;现状分析  营养与食品卫生学是一门社会性、科学性、应用性和实践性较强的专业性学科,其中实验教学在本学科中占有重要地位,它是理论联系实践的纽带。因此,积极开展实验教学
期刊
摘要:目前,随着社会的发展,我国的教育水平的发函也突飞猛进。在小学语文教学中,写作教学是教学的重点,也是教学的难点,其对学生的学习与发展具有重要的影响。很多小学生在日常写作中经常苦恼无内容可写、无话可说。面对这种现状,教师应采取有效的教学策略,提高小学生的习作能力,调动学生习作的积极性,使学生习作水平大幅度提高。  关键词:利用专题教育社区;提高;学生习作能力  引言  在当前小学习作教学中存在着
期刊
摘要:通过对民办高职院校心理健康教育和职业生涯规划教育的现状进行调查了解,发现两者都存在着师资专业水平缺乏、基础设施不完善、资金投入不足等共同问题。同时分析两者在教育中又存在相互融合、相互交叉、共同促进的作用。因此,将职业生涯规划教育内容融入到心理健康教育中去,不仅可以使学校职业生涯规划教育的实施更为系统有序;而且可以使心理健康教育的内容更为具体化,更具时效性。  关键词:高职生;职业生涯规划;心
期刊
摘要: 作为企业管理的重要组成部分,人力资源管理对构建企业核心竞争力有着巨大的作用。随着互联网技术的快速发展和大数据时代的到来,企业人力资源管理模式也面临着挑战和机遇,部分企业开始利用大数据来处理庞大的人力资源信息。新时代要进行企业人力资源管理模式的创新,提升人力资源管理水平,建立全新的信息系统,使得企业在激烈的市场竞争中稳步向前,实现可持续发展。本文从企业人力资源管理模式入手,对现状进行分析,并
期刊
摘要:中职语文课是中职教学中的一门公共基础课,在中职课程体系中占有比较重要的地位。本文分析了中职语文课堂教学现状,提出新时期中职语文课堂教学效率提升策略。  关键词:职业学校语文;教学效率;中职教学  课堂效率是课堂教学的灵魂,也是新课改目标本质化目标的体现。中职语文教师作为教学的重要组成部分,实施相关程度的教学工作内容风格及其教书育人的良好氛围营造,势必在语文教学的完善和发展中,为提升语文课堂的
期刊
摘要:中国优秀传统文化经过五千年扬弃和积淀逐渐形成并发展起来的,大学生教育应与中国优秀传统文化深度融合,成为激励大学生增强个人自尊心、民族自信心和自豪感动力。将中国优秀传统文化融入大学生教育的课程建设、环境建设等方面培养有理想、有担当的新时代青年。  关键词:中国优秀传统文化;深度融入;  教育在目前高职院校教育教学中占据着重要的地位,一方面,教育是高职院校教育教学的必要内容;另一方面,高职院校教
期刊
摘要: 诚实信用是产生于道德观念的一个法律原则,随着法学的发展,诚实信用原则已从私法领域过渡到公法领域。行政法诚实信用原则已经成为我国行政法中的一项基本原则,在行政法的各个领域都以适用。该原则既可以促进我国诚信政府的建设,又可以完善我国行政法治理念,具有重要的现实意义。  关键词: 行政法;诚实信用;基本原则  一、诚实信用原则的内涵  诚实信用原则在我国行政法中的首次提出应当是2003年我国《行
期刊
摘要:随着我国高校不断扩招以及规模不断扩大,大批青年教师加入高校教师队伍,提高青年教师教学能力关乎高校整体教学质量。因此有效提高我国高等院校青年教师的教学能力成为各高校重要任务之一。青年教师教学比赛成为高校青年教师提升教学能力的平台,既可以通过比赛展示自我,又可以通过比赛互相交流学习,提升自身教学素养,促进教学水平的提高。通过教学比赛,青年教师可以进一步突破教学瓶颈、提高教學语言艺术性、增加教学模
期刊
大数据时代,传媒教育行业被赋予了前所未有的责任和重担,同时也提出了空前的挑战,只有将大数据与新闻传播学相结合,学习并掌握新的思考方法和新的技能,研究如何将大数据有效地运用到传媒教育当中,才能推动传媒教育事业的突破性发展。随着数字技术、网络技术、信息技术的飞速发展,媒介环境和传播形态发生了深刻变化,全媒体传播、全媒体竞合、全媒体运营成为传媒业发展的必然趋势.传媒业全媒体化发展迫切需要新型传媒人才的支
期刊
摘要:藏语作文教学受地域文化、人文环境、地方方言制约给教师设置了一个有待攻克的难题。也给志在民族教育的教师设置了共同探讨的环境和攻克目标。  关键词:起步作文;教学策略;情感;方式;策略  藏语文作文教学由于藏区受地域文化、交通经济、人文环境、地方方言、学前教育等的限制,导致藏语文作文教学一直是整个藏语文教学活动中的一个有待突破的难题。我县小学生由于大多数来自不同农牧村,孩子们虽然会说藏语,但只停
期刊